btpan_interface_t-Strukturreferenz

btpan_interface_t-Strukturreferenz

#include < bt_pan.h >

Datenfelder

size_t  size
 
bt_status_t (*  init )(const btpan_callbacks_t *callbacks)
 
bt_status_t (*  enable )(int local_role)
 
int(*  get_local_role )(void)
 
bt_status_t (*  connect )(const bt_bdaddr_t *bd_addr, int local_role, int remote_role)
 
bt_status_t (*  disconnect )(const bt_bdaddr_t *bd_addr)
 
void(*  cleanup )(void)
 

Detaillierte Beschreibung

Definition in Zeile 51 der Datei bt_pan.h .

Felddokumentation

void(* cleanup)(void)

Oberfläche für Schwenken optimieren

Definition in Zeile 81 der Datei bt_pan.h .

bt_status_t (* connect)(const bt_bdaddr_t *bd_addr, int local_role, int remote_role)

Startet eine Bluetooth-PAN-Verbindung zum Remotegerät über die angegebene PAN-Rolle. Der Ergebnisstatus wird von btpan_connection_state_callback zurückgegeben.

Definition in Zeile 72 der Datei bt_pan.h .

bt_status_t (* disconnect)(const bt_bdaddr_t *bd_addr)

Bluetooth-PAN-Verbindung beenden Der Ergebnisstatus wird von btpan_connection_state_callback zurückgegeben.

Definition in Zeile 76 der Datei bt_pan.h .

bt_status_t (* enable)(int local_role)

Definition in Zeile 63 der Datei bt_pan.h .

int(* get_local_role)(void)

Definition in Zeile 67 der Datei bt_pan.h .

bt_status_t (* init)(const btpan_callbacks_t *callbacks)

Die Pan-Benutzeroberfläche initialisieren und die btpan-Callbacks registrieren

Definition in Zeile 57 der Datei bt_pan.h .

size_t-Größe

auf die Größe dieses Typs festgelegt

Definition in Zeile 53 der Datei bt_pan.h .


Die Dokumentation für diese Struktur wurde aus der folgenden Datei generiert: